- Forman_Park abstract "Forman Park, in Syracuse, New York, was first established on June 16, 1839 and was known as Forman Square. The main attraction is a bronze memorial of early civic leaders, Joshua Forman and Lewis H. Redfield. Redfield was a pioneer printer who died in 1882. Before his death he wrote a detailed account of the land ownership over the years and immortalized the history of the park in early print. The park is 1.3 acres and is located at East Genesee and Almond Streets in Downtown Syracuse.".
